Peter,
This is why I started out a week ago saying that recursion is a
version 2.0 feature, not a version 1.0 feature, for lots of
very obvious business reasons.
We need buy in and we need ease of implementation to a
broad global community.
Tim Bray's criteria - that an XML parser should be easily
implementable with two to three weeks work by a
graduate student - should not be forgotten in this context.
Not to mention another criteria - do you really want to be
debugging @ 2am in the morning on a transaction with
45,000 lines in it that failed because of a recursive reference
somewhere in it??!
